European markets fall after Trump tariff menace

Graeme Wearden

Graeme Wearden

Donald Trump’s menace to impose a 30% on European Union imports from subsequent month is weighing on European inventory markets this morning.

Most of Europe’s markets have dropped firstly of buying and selling, pulling the pan-European Stoxx 600 index down by 0.6%.

Germany’s DAX has dropped by 0.95%, whereas France’s CAC 40 has misplaced 0.8%, Italy’s FTSE MIB index is sort of 0.9% decrease, and Spain’s IBEX is off 0.7%.

Traders will likely be assessing the possibilities of the 2 sides reaching a deal by 1 August.

EU reacts to Trump menace – snap evaluation

Lisa O'Carroll

Lisa O’Carroll

A present of unity is predicted publicly with German chancellor Friedrich Merz saying he’ll work “intensively” with Emmanuel Macron, Ursula von der Leyen and Trump to attempt to rescue the settlement in precept that was placed on Trump’s desk final week involving tariffs of 10%.

Over the previous three months Germany has urged a fast UK fashion deal whereas Macron has favoured a harder stance to face down Trump, given common tariffs earlier than his presidency had been 2.5% and so they breach WTO guidelines.

The EU’s continued and future reliance on the US for safety and defence is influencing the place with member states accepting a commerce off between enterprise and arms and army intelligence Trump gives.

On Sunday, Merz advised the ARD broadcaster that a 30% tariff would “hit our exporters to the core” whereas the German automotive trade referred to as for a fast deal.

He stated he agreed with Macron, who stated on Saturday the EU needed to “step up the preparation of credible countermeasures” within the occasion of no deal earlier than 1 August.

In his assertion Saturday, Macron additionally urged the European Fee – which negotiates on behalf of all EU international locations – to “resolutely defend European interests”.

Italy, one of many three international locations together with Germany and Eire, that promote extra to the US than import stated a commerce warfare can be a catastrophe.

Italian prime minister Giorgia Meloni stated in a press release Sunday: “A trade war within the West would weaken us all in the face of the global challenges we are confronting together.

The EU sees the threat of €21bn package of countermeasures imposed on 1 August as leverage.

“Europe has the economic and financial strength to assert its position and reach a fair and sensible agreement,” she stated, a line underlined by Italy’s overseas minister Antonio Tajani as we speak.

“Tariffs hurt every one, starting with the United States,” he stated.

If inventory markets fall that places in danger the pensions and the financial savings of the Individuals.

Trump’s Ukraine envoy arrives in Kyiv

Within the final hour, Trump’s Ukraine envoy Keith Kellogg arrived in Kyiv for talks on safety and sanctions in opposition to Russia.

Head of the Workplace of the President of Ukraine Andriy Yermak embraces US Particular Envoy for Ukraine Keith Kellogg after his arrival, amid Russia’s assault on Ukraine, in Kyiv, Ukraine. {Photograph}: Andriy Yermak/Telegram/Reuters

The top of the Ukrainian presidential administration, Andriy Yermak, already signalled that one thing was afoot over the weekend, posting on Sunday a side-eye emoji image suggesting an announcement was coming.

After Trump confirmed his intentions to ship extra Patriot missiles to Ukraine, Yermak added extra element disclosing Kellogg will participate in discussions on “defence, strengthening security, weapons, sanctions, protecting our people.”

Ukrainian president Volodymyr Zelenskyy individually stated that Kellogg will likely be given a army briefing and meet with the heads of the Safety Service of Ukraine and intelligence companies.

Trump guarantees ‘main assertion’ on Russia as we speak

Talking in a single day, the US president, Donald Trump, stated he can be making “a major statement” on Russia on Monday.

US President Donald Trump waves after exiting Marine One on the South Garden of the White Home in Washington DC. {Photograph}: Bonnie Money/EPA

We have no idea all the main points of what he’ll announce by way of assist for Ukraine, however he confirmed that the US “will send them Patriots, which they desperately need.”

“We basically are going to send them various pieces of very sophisticated military and they’re going to pay us 100 percent for them,” he stated, including it was good “business for us.”

The announcement comes simply over per week after a short pause within the US army support deliveries for Ukraine, and days after Trump misplaced endurance with Russian president Vladimir Putin accusing him of speaking “bullshit.”

Individually, US lawmakers are engaged on a bipartisan invoice that might impose robust sanctions on Russia.

Nato secretary common, Mark Rutte, is in Washington on Monday so count on him to be concerned in all talks on each points.
